Hi Ballygall. Combine a half-cup of white vinegar and one cup warm water in a spray bottle, for use on plastic, nylon and synthetic leather upholstery. If the furniture is badly soiled, add a half-tablespoon of natural liquid soap. Then shake the spray bottle and mist the soiled area lightly with the spray bottle. Scrub the area in a circular motion with a soft cloth, working the cleaner into the nap of the fabric. Reapply as necessary, until the soiled area comes clean.
